Set to be rigged with twin Mercury Racing Verado 400R outboard engines, the first Wright Performance 420 catamaran will be on display at the 2019 Miami International Boat Show, https://speedonthewater.com/new-boat...ce-boat-center.

Yeah, it really does look bigger. Brett Manire of Performance Boat Center said it is 11 percent larger overall than the 360, which actually is substantial. But it looks even bigger than that.
And for those who are interested—and it seem like waterline/running surface length is a hot topic right now—the running surface measures 38'4" as noted in the article.
Side by sides were courtesy of Mr. Manire. All thanks go to him.
